Dissident artist Oleg Vorotnikov says he now supports President Vladimir Putin and wants to return to Russia if police there drop charges against him. In an interview with RFE/RL's Current Time TV, Vorotnikov told host Timur Olevskiy that he became disappointed with Russia's political opposition. The founding member of the art collective Voina (War) is currently in Prague where he is fighting extradition to Russia. He was involved in a series of high-profile stunts challenging Russian authorities and says he faces charges of resisting arrest. (RFE/RL's Current Time TV)
